    I worked in the industry for 50+ years - the first 25 were in a industry that was looking for a place to die; don't invest because other forms of transportation will eliminate the NEED for railroads. Then Staggers was enacted. It took a few years, and the retirement of some industry 'leaders' but there came along leaders that saw what could be accomplished in operating a railroad like a business - a business operating for profit. That form of 'enlightened' business turn railroads into profitable properties that had the financial resources to roll back into their plant in form of track and facilities maintenance and enhancement as well as improving the efficiency of equipment and motive power as well as securing tools to enhance the efficiency of many areas of the workforce. Then along came EHH and his hedge fund bean counters that know the price of everything and the value of nothing planting the flag of PSR to run the carriers downhill to the decrepit condition of the carriers before Staggers - a condition of self inflicted deferred maintenance, this time in the name of 'shareholder value' as opposed to just trying to make to the next day as it was leading up to the enactment of Staggers.
